Eyes were treated as previously described6 (link),11 . Briefly, mice were sacrificed 2 weeks after laser-induced CNV. Enucleated eyes were fixed for 1 h in 1% paraformaldehyde (#15,713-S, Electron Microscopy Sciences, Hatfield, PA) at room temperature. Eyes were washed in Tris-buffered saline (TBS) and dissected to remove conjunctiva, cornea, iris, ciliary body, lens, and retina leaving a posterior eye cup of RPE, choroid, and sclera. Eye cups were blocked in TBS + 5% Donkey serum (S30, Sigma-Aldrich), then treated with an anti-ICAM-2 primary antibody (1:500, Table 1), and Alexa Fluor 488-conjugated anti-rat secondary antibody (Table 1). Pictures were captured on a Ti2 widefield microscope (Nikon, Melville, NY). Area was quantified using Fiji by a reviewer blinded to animal identification.
